Germany, Wehrmacht. A Silver Grade Wound Badge, With Case, By Klein & Quenzer Archive Solingen) with the company's squirrel(Verwundetenabzeichen in Silber). Constructed of silvered zink, the obverse consisting of an oval laurel leaf wreath, joined together at the bottom by ribbon, around a central raised Stahlhelm overlaid by a mobile swastika, on top of crossed swords on a pebbled field, the reverse with an integral hinge and vertical pinback meeting an integral catch, maker marked with Prsidialkanzlei code 65 for Klein & Quenzer, Idar Oberstein, measuring 36. 80 mm (w)
